What is Cryptocurrency?
Definition and Basic Concept
Cryptocurrency is a digital or virtual form of currency that
utilizes cryptographic techniques to secure transactions, control
the creation of additional units, and verify the transfer of assets.
Unlike traditional fiat currencies issued by central banks,
cryptocurrencies operate on decentralized networks based on
blockchain technology—a distributed ledger enforced by a disparate
network of computers.
The first and most well-known cryptocurrency, Bitcoin, was created
in 2009 by an anonymous entity known as Satoshi Nakamoto. Since
then, thousands of alternative cryptocurrencies (commonly called
"altcoins") have been developed, each with varying features and
purposes.

Key Features of Cryptocurrency
-
Decentralization – Unlike traditional banking
systems, cryptocurrencies typically operate without a central
authority, distributing control across a network of computers.
-
Transparency – Most cryptocurrency transactions
are recorded on a public ledger (blockchain), visible to all
network participants.
-
Immutability – Once recorded, transactions cannot
be altered or deleted, preventing fraud and manipulation.
-
Limited Supply – Many cryptocurrencies have a
fixed maximum supply, creating digital scarcity similar to
precious metals like gold.
-
Pseudonymity – While transactions are
transparent, user identities are protected through cryptographic
addresses.
-
Global Accessibility – Cryptocurrencies can be
accessed and transferred anywhere with internet connectivity,
bypassing traditional financial gatekeepers.
How Does Cryptocurrency Work?
Cryptocurrencies operate on blockchain technology, which functions
as a distributed digital ledger. When a transaction is initiated, it
is broadcast to a peer-to-peer network of computers known as nodes.
These nodes validate the transaction using known algorithms.
Verified transactions are combined into blocks that are
cryptographically linked to preceding blocks, forming a chain. This
blockchain is maintained across all network participants, creating a
transparent and tamper-resistant record of all transactions.
The two primary consensus mechanisms that secure blockchain networks
are:
-
Proof of Work (PoW) – Miners compete to solve
complex mathematical problems to validate transactions and create
new blocks (e.g., Bitcoin).
-
Proof of Stake (PoS) – Validators are chosen to
create new blocks based on the amount of cryptocurrency they hold
and are willing to "stake" as collateral (e.g., Ethereum 2.0).
Brief History of Cryptocurrency
The conceptual foundation for cryptocurrency dates back to the 1980s
with the development of cryptographic techniques and digital cash
concepts. However, the modern cryptocurrency era began in 2009 with
the launch of Bitcoin.
Key milestones include:
-
2009 - Bitcoin network goes live with the mining
of the genesis block
-
2011 - Emergence of alternative cryptocurrencies
(Namecoin, Litecoin)
-
2015 - Ethereum launches with smart contract
functionality
-
2017 - Initial Coin Offering (ICO) boom and first
major bull market
-
2020-2021 - Institutional adoption accelerates
and DeFi/NFT ecosystems expand
-
2022-2023 - Market correction followed by
regulatory developments

Investment Strategy Considerations
-
Portfolio Allocation – Determine what
percentage of your overall investment portfolio should be
allocated to cryptocurrency based on your risk tolerance
(typically 1-5% for conservative investors, up to 10-20% for
more aggressive positions).
-
Diversification – Spread investments across
different cryptocurrencies rather than concentrating on a single
asset. Consider a core-satellite approach with Bitcoin and
Ethereum as core holdings and selective altcoins for growth
potential.
-
Investment Horizon – Define your time horizon
(short-term vs. long-term) and align investments accordingly.
Cryptocurrency markets are volatile, making them generally more
suitable for long-term investment horizons.
-
Dollar-Cost Averaging – Consider investing
fixed amounts at regular intervals rather than trying to time
the market, reducing the impact of volatility.
-
Fundamental Analysis – Evaluate projects based
on technology, team, adoption, tokenomics, and competitive
positioning rather than solely on price action.
How to Research Cryptocurrencies
Thorough research is essential before investing in any
cryptocurrency:
-
Whitepaper Analysis – Read the project's
whitepaper to understand its purpose, technology, and
implementation plan.
-
Team Evaluation – Research the development team's
experience, credentials, and track record.
-
Technology Assessment – Evaluate the technical
merits of the blockchain, including scalability, security, and
innovation.
-
Community and Development Activity – Monitor
GitHub repositories, community channels, and social media to gauge
developer activity and community support.
-
Partnerships and Adoption – Look for real-world
adoption, enterprise partnerships, and integration with existing
systems.
-
Tokenomics – Understand the token distribution,
inflation schedule, and utility within the ecosystem.
Understanding Cryptocurrency Risks
While cryptocurrency offers potential opportunities, it also carries
significant risks that investors must understand:
Major Risk Factors
-
Volatility – Cryptocurrency prices can
experience extreme fluctuations in short periods.
-
Regulatory Uncertainty – Changing regulations
can significantly impact cryptocurrency values and
accessibility.
-
Security Risks – Exchange hacks, wallet
vulnerabilities, and phishing attacks can lead to loss of funds.
-
Technological Risks – Bugs, network failures,
or successful attacks on blockchain networks.
-
Adoption Risks – Potential failure to achieve
widespread adoption or technological obsolescence.
-
Liquidity Risks – Some cryptocurrencies may
have limited trading volume, making it difficult to enter or
exit positions.
Risk Mitigation Strategies
- Use reputable exchanges with strong security measures
-
Store most assets in cold storage (hardware wallets) rather than
on exchanges
-
Diversify across different cryptocurrencies and asset classes
- Only invest what you can afford to lose completely
- Stay informed about regulatory developments
-
Implement strong security practices including two-factor
authentication
